    Stream habitat improved after dam removal at Fort McCoy

    Silver Creek on South Post is shown Aug. 4, 2017, after work to remove a dam was completed there by the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ources in coordination with the Directorate of Public Works Environmental Division Natural Resources Branch at Fort McCoy, Wis. The West Silver Wetland Dam, located on Fort McCoy's South Post near the Sparta-Fort McCoy Airport, has been in place on Silver Creek since 1952 and now is in the process of being removed. Work to remove the West Silver Wetland Dam began in early July and was completed in August by a crew that specializes in improving streams and returning them to a natural state.
